About the Role
Our client is a U.S.-focused company operating within the credit and financial data space, supporting credit automation and credit pull database solutions for mainland clients. Due to growth, they are expanding their finance team and seeking an experienced Accounts Receivable (AR) Specialist to support billing and collections operations.
This is a hands-on, on-site role ideal for professionals who are detail-oriented, organized, and comfortable working with U.S.-based customers in a structured, compliance-driven environment.
🕘 Schedule: Monday–Friday 9:00 AM – 6:00 PM
💼 Compensation: $40,000 base salary + benefits
What You’ll Do
-
Monitor customer accounts to ensure timely payment and follow up on outstanding balances
-
Apply payments accurately (checks, ACH, e-checks, and credit cards)
-
Execute strategic collections efforts across assigned U.S. accounts
-
Communicate professionally with customers regarding billing questions and payment issues
-
Maintain accurate AR aging reports and detailed account records
-
Assist with month-end close related to accounts receivable
-
Support internal audits by providing AR documentation
-
Collaborate with finance and operations teams to ensure accuracy and compliance
What We’re Looking For
-
2+ years of experience in accounts receivable, collections, or general accounting
-
Strong understanding of AR processes and collections best practices
-
Experience working with accounting or billing systems (NetSuite preferred)
-
Intermediate Excel skills
-
Excellent attention to detail and time management
-
Strong written and verbal communication skills
-
Fluent in English (spoken and written); Spanish is a plus
-
Ability to manage multiple accounts while maintaining professionalism
